服务器测评网
我们一直在努力

Linux环境下如何高效导出MySQL数据库数据的方法与技巧?

Linux导出MySQL数据库数据教程

Linux环境下如何高效导出MySQL数据库数据的方法与技巧?

准备工作

在开始导出MySQL数据库数据之前,请确保您已经安装了MySQL服务器,并且已经登录到MySQL服务器,以下是在Linux环境下导出MySQL数据库数据的基本步骤。

登录MySQL服务器

您需要登录到MySQL服务器,使用以下命令登录:

mysql -u root -p

输入您的MySQL root用户密码,登录成功后,您将看到MySQL提示符。

选择数据库

登录成功后,使用以下命令选择您要导出的数据库:

USE 数据库名;

将“数据库名”替换为您要导出的数据库的实际名称。

Linux环境下如何高效导出MySQL数据库数据的方法与技巧?

导出数据库

导出数据库有多种方法,以下是一些常用的方法:

使用mysqldump命令导出

mysqldump是MySQL提供的一个强大的工具,可以用来导出数据库或数据表,以下是一个基本的mysqldump命令示例:

mysqldump -u 用户名 -p 数据库名 > 导出文件.sql

执行上述命令后,系统会提示您输入MySQL用户密码,密码输入后,mysqldump会开始导出数据库,并将导出的数据保存到指定的文件中。

使用mysql命令行导出

如果您熟悉MySQL命令行,可以使用以下命令直接在命令行中导出数据库:

mysql -u 用户名 -p 数据库名 > 导出文件.sql

同样,执行上述命令后,系统会提示您输入MySQL用户密码,密码输入后,MySQL命令行会开始导出数据库,并将导出的数据保存到指定的文件中。

使用phpMyAdmin导出

如果您使用的是phpMyAdmin,可以通过图形界面导出数据库,以下是步骤:

  1. 登录phpMyAdmin。
  2. 选择您要导出的数据库。
  3. 点击“导出”按钮。
  4. 选择导出格式(如SQL、CSV等)。
  5. 点击“导出”按钮,下载导出的文件。

导出特定数据表

Linux环境下如何高效导出MySQL数据库数据的方法与技巧?

如果您只想导出数据库中的特定数据表,可以在mysqldump命令中指定数据表名称:

mysqldump -u 用户名 -p 数据库名 表名1 表名2 > 导出文件.sql

将“表名1”和“表名2”替换为您要导出的数据表名称。

导出特定字段

如果您只想导出特定字段,可以在mysqldump命令中使用--fields-terminated-by--fields-enclosed-by选项:

mysqldump -u 用户名 -p 数据库名 表名 --fields-terminated-by=';' --fields-enclosed-by='"' > 导出文件.sql

这将导出指定数据表的特定字段。

注意事项

  • 在导出数据库时,请确保您有足够的磁盘空间来存储导出的文件。
  • 如果您需要频繁导出数据库,建议定期清理旧的导出文件,以节省磁盘空间。
  • 在导出敏感数据时,请确保使用安全的传输方式,如通过SSH进行安全传输。

通过以上步骤,您可以在Linux环境下成功导出MySQL数据库数据。

赞(0)
未经允许不得转载:好主机测评网 » Linux环境下如何高效导出MySQL数据库数据的方法与技巧?